I’m collecting Hockey Hall of Famers, one card per player who has a reasonable card to find.
With this quest, I have run into many guys whose history I didn’t know.
I ended up buying a Mickey Ions card from back when he was still a player (he started in lacrosse)

When I got a Red Horner card, I researched him to find that he was the main retaliator for Toronto , sticking up for Ace Bailey in that game.
He was suspended along with Eddie Shore.

So I thought I’d recreate the main characters in this fascinating moment of Hockey history by gathering cards of Bailey/Shore/Horner and the referee.
I was kinda hoping it was Ions because my subset would be complete🤓

The Cleghorne connection is equally cool, as Sprague was known as a great enforcer/tough guy/ maybe a dirty player .
I have a Sprague Cleghorne card, now I will add one of his brother Odie!
